MSNBC host Chris Matthews expressed outrage on Friday upon
hearing reports that Special Counsel Robert Mueller had
completed his Russia investigation and submitted it to the
attorney general -- with further indictments not expected.
Matthews began his show by summarizing the breaking news, but
stressed that Mueller handed his report to the Department of
Justice “without ever directly interviewing the president of the
United States.”
“That means no charges against the president, his children or
his associates after all those meetings with the Russians,” a
visibly upset Matthews told his viewers.
The liberal cable news host opened the discussion to the panel,
telling them his “biggest question” was “How can the president
be pointed to as leading collusion with Russia, aiding a Russian
conspiracy to interfere with our elections if none of his
henchmen, none of his children, none of his associates have been
indicted?”

NBC News national security reporter Ken Dilanian responded by
telling Matthews that Trump couldn’t be indicted “in a criminal
sense” since Mueller’s office “didn’t have it,” adding that the
president “couldn’t conspire with himself.”
“Maybe he missed the boat here,” Matthews responded. “Because we
know about the Trump Tower meeting in June 2016, we know about
the meeting at the cigar bar with Kilimnik. My God, we know
about all of those meetings with Kislyak at the Republican
convention in Cleveland. All these dots we’re now to believe
don’t connect.”
“Well, that’s the conclusion in front of us,” Dilanian told
Matthews. “All of that stuff was suggestive, it didn’t prove
anything.”
“Why was there never an interrogation of this president?”
Matthews shot back. “We were told for weeks by experts, ‘You
cannot deal with an obstruction-of-justice charge or
investigation without getting the motive… How could they let
Trump off the hook?... He will not be charged with obstruction
of justice or collusion without having to sit down with the
Special Counsel Mueller and answer his damn questions. How could
that happen?”
